Bulk delete all Vulnerabilities that match the given request.
One or more query params must be supplied to specify Properties to delete by. If more than one Property is provided, data will be deleted that matches ALL of the Properties (e.g. treated as an AND). Read the POST bulk endpoint documentation for more details.
E.g. DELETE /bulkByProperties?accountId=account-123&createdBy=user-456
Deletion is performed asynchronously. The GET vulnerability endpoint can be used to confirm that data has been deleted successfully (if needed).
